Consider the following

  1. Star tortoise
  2. Monitor lizard
  3. Pygmy Hog
  4. Spider monkey

Which of the above found in India?

Select an option to attempt

Explanation

The Star tortoise, Monitor lizard, and Pygmy Hog are all species that are naturally found in India.

The Star tortoise is a medium-sized species of tortoise found in the dry and arid forests of India.

Monitor lizards are prevalent in India with four kinds occurring Bengal monitor lizard, water monitor lizard, desert monitor lizard, and yellow monitor lizard.

The Pygmy Hog is a critically endangered species that was once found in Bhutan, Nepal, and India but is now only found in India.

However, Spider monkeys are not found in India. They live in tropical climates, specifically the evergreen forests of Central and South America.

Therefore, the correct answer is 1, 2, and 3 only.
